The Parakeets of Windsor

Ian Warner, Mon 16th Jun ’08

On a recent trip back to my old hometown of Windsor, I was stood in the garden of my parents when a flock of seven loudly squawking, bright green parakeets flew overhead. My mother insisted that this was perfectly normal, and that the parakeets had been around in Windsor since at least the early 1970s. [...]

Wren’s Superfluous Columns

Ian Warner, Fri 9th Feb ’07

The Guildhall, Windsor
The story of the Guildhall in Windsor, England, is a nice one, regardless of how much of it is true, and how much of it is well-kept local legend.
Sir Christopher Wren took over the task of constructing the Guildhall from Sir Thomas Fitz who had started work on it in 1687 and died [...]
